I second Jester's recommendation...
also, Fender non-Squier Jazz basses are pretty nice too...
it really depends on your bass tone too... if you're looking for something more "dead-thud type sounding", the Fender Jazz basses are great... if you're looking for more of a funk, live sound, the ibanez's make really good sounds...

| Any of the Soundgear series are good Ibanez, that's what model my 6-string is. I like the sound of the BTB series, but they might be a bit pricey for you at this point. Basically just do the guitar shop hop & try all of 'em out, figure out which one you like best.
